首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

GitHub操作使用哪个版本的git,我可以设置为特定版本吗?

GitHub操作使用的是Git版本控制系统。Git是一个开源的分布式版本控制系统,用于管理和追踪文件的变化。GitHub是一个基于Git的代码托管平台,提供了代码托管、版本控制、协作开发等功能。

在GitHub上进行操作时,默认使用的是最新版本的Git。GitHub会定期更新其使用的Git版本,以提供更好的功能和性能。

在GitHub上,你无法直接设置特定版本的Git。GitHub会自动使用最新版本的Git来处理你的操作。这是因为GitHub需要保持与Git的兼容性,并提供最新的功能和修复的bug。

然而,你可以在本地的开发环境中设置特定版本的Git。你可以通过下载并安装特定版本的Git来使用。Git官方网站(https://git-scm.com/)提供了各个版本的Git下载。你可以根据自己的需求选择合适的版本进行安装和使用。

需要注意的是,无论你使用的是哪个版本的Git,你都可以将代码推送到GitHub上进行托管和协作开发。GitHub会自动处理你的代码,并与Git进行兼容。

腾讯云提供了一系列与Git相关的产品和服务,例如腾讯云代码托管(https://cloud.tencent.com/product/coderepo)和腾讯云DevOps(https://cloud.tencent.com/product/devops)等。这些产品和服务可以帮助开发者更好地管理和协作开发他们的代码。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

工程化专题之Git前言Github && Git一些重要概念Git在实际中使用方式Git常用命令总结

Star:想你或多或少浏览过github开源项目,你可以star它们,可以理解收藏意思。在github上,拥有很多star,那是很牛事情。...Git在实际中使用方式 Git有命令客户端Git Bash,也有图像客户端,如TortoiseGit,不过掌握Git最佳方式依然是命令行。 Git必要设置 ?...git config 为什么要设置用户名、邮箱呢? 显然,你要提交代码,肯定要告诉GIT,你是哪个,这是一个标示。至于邮箱,是因为很多时候,GIT如果要进行通知的话,可以给你发邮件。...而且对于GIT仓库而言,是可以根据用户来设置权限git init && git clone ?...(这将是我们操作基础信息) git branch git status/git status -s 接下来,明确我们要在哪个分支上开发,从master创建分支开发?

66020

【腾讯云 Cloud Studio 实战训练营】在线 IDE 编写 canvas 转换黑白风格头像

图片如果大家有 github 账号,那么推荐你使用 github 来注册,这样你编写好代码可以一键保存到 github 上。...如果没有 github 账号,可以先去注册“CODING DevOps”,然后使用“CODING DevOps”账号登录。第二步:创建自己工作空间登录好以后,先点击左下角新建工作空间。...图片在跳转页面中,可以配置你项目将要托管到哪个服务商,这里支持 coding 和 github图片因为最开始推荐大家使用 github 登录,所以这里选择 github,就会自动同步github团队和项目图片是不是很方便...所以,你要自己手动执行 git init、git remote add origin 、git add .、git commit以及git push等操作。...,核心逻辑大概是这样:通过设置 input 属性 type file,来获取上传头像绘制一个静态 canvas 到页面上,用来当作画布使用 canvas drawImage 方法将获取头像绘制到画布上使用

16540
  • GitGit-LFS无法解决机器学习复现问题时,是时候祭出DVC了

    不仅仅是 2GB 限制,GithubGit-LFS 使用免费层也设置了严格限制,使用者必须购买涵盖数据和带宽使用数据计划。...有一个 DIY Git-LFS 服务器可以在 AWS S3 上存储文件,网址是 https://github.com/meltingice/git-lfs-s3,但是设置自定义 Git-LFS 服务器需要额外工作...使用 Git-LFS 解决了所谓机器学习复现危机使用 Git-LFS 后,你机器学习团队可以更好地控制数据,因为它现在是版本控制。这是否意味着问题已解决?...DVC 可以精准记录时间点和使用文件 DVC 核心是存储和版本控制大文件而优化数据存储(DVC 缓存)。团队可以选择将哪些文件存储在 SCM(如 Git)中,哪些存储在 DVC 中。...最重要是,这意味着不需再费尽周章记住每个实验使用哪个版本脚本。DVC 会跟踪所有内容。 ?

    2K30

    Git 常用命令,建议收藏 !

    你好,是田哥 前两天,知识星球里一位朋友咨询Git怎么搞,那么多命令难道要全部记下来? 答案是:没有必要,作为多年使用Git,其实很多命令也没用过。...(版本号,这只是个例子,此值不必写全,只要能让git知道是哪个把那本就行,一般写5-6位即可) 撤销修改(撤销到最近一次git add或git commit之前状态) git checkout --...README.md(文件名) 撤销暂存区修改(git commit之前) git reset HEAD README.md(文件名) 删除文件(确定删除需要git commit,若误删可以使用git...若存在多个保存工作空间(n序号0开始) git stash apply stash@{n} 删除保存工作空间 git stash drop 若存在多个保存工作空间(n序号0开始) git...推送某个标签到远程 git push origin v1.0 推送全部尚未推送标签 git push origin --tags 同一套代码关联多个远程库(同时关联github和gitee

    30120

    2021年排名前85DevOps面试问答

    集散控制系统 每个开发人员都在其系统上拥有所有版本代码副本 使团队成员可以脱机工作,并且不依赖单个位置进行备份 即使服务器崩溃,也没有威胁 16.将任何存储库从GitHub下载到您计算机git命令是什么...从GitHub将任何存储库下载到您计算机git命令是 git clone。 17.如何使用Git将文件从本地系统推送到GitHub存储库?...使用GitHub冲突编辑器解决 在争夺线路更改后导致合并冲突时,可以执行此操作。例如,当人们对您Git存储库中不同分支上同一文件同一行进行不同更改时,可能会发生这种情况。...可以将Jenkins配置采用已部署应用程序服务器使用身份验证机制。 36.如何部署核心插件自定义版本?...资源是任何配置管理工具基本单元。 这些是节点功能,例如其软件包或服务。 写在目录中资源声明描述了要对该资源执行操作或与该资源一起执行操作。 执行目录时,它将节点设置所需状态。 57.

    6.7K30

    Windows下git安装使用教程

    git安装 打开浏览器输入Git官网网站回车即可打开Git官网; 点击里面的“Downloads for Windows”即调整到下载页面等待下载即可,现在最新版本2.10.1 下载安装包名为Git...,以便确定要回退到哪个版本。...要重返未来,用git reflog查看命令历史,以便确定要回到未来哪个版本。...这个警告只会出现一次,后面的操作就不会有任何警告了。 如果你实在担心有人冒充GitHub服务器,输入yes前可以对照GitHubRSA Key信息是否与SSH连接给出一致。...先用共享模式把整个目录 都设置不跟踪,然后再用保守模式把这个文件夹中想要跟踪文件设置被跟踪,配置很简单,就可以跟踪想要跟踪文件。 ---- ubuntu安装使用git 1.

    7.9K10

    GitGitHub小册

    克隆GitHub 仓库到本地 你将学会使用命令将GitHub仓库克隆到本地。 就以我们前面创建演示仓库克隆目标。使用下面的命令: git clone [仓库地址] 即可。...若之前那次版本号为 3c336e0提交是正确,刚才版本回退操作全都是误操作,怎么办?再次执行一次版本回退?不需要。...,那么冒号后面的部分(包括冒号)可以省略不写 git pull origin master ---- Git分支操作 git命令设置别名 通过上面的操作一路走来,大概你也发现了有些命令重复度极高,比如...执行 git checkout [分支名] 切换分支,注意,这把该命令设置一个别名 ch,后面用时候都会使用该别名进行。...git commit --amend --only 该命令会打开你设置默认编辑器方便编辑,如图是vim,如果你不想这样做,也可以一行命令解决。

    44620

    看完这篇还不会用Git,那我就哭了!

    使用Git ?也许你已经使用了一段时间,但它许多奥秘仍然令人困惑。 Git 是一个版本控制系统,是任何软件开发项目中主要内容。通常有两个主要用途:代码备份和代码版本控制。...你可以逐步处理代码,在需要回滚到备份副本过程中保存每一步进度! 常见问题是 Git 很难使用。有时版本和分支不同步,你会花很长时间试图推送代码!...更糟糕是,不知道某些命令的确切工作方式很容易导致意外删除或覆盖部分代码! 这就是写本文原因,从而学习到如何正确使用 Git,以便在开发中共同进行编码!...使用 cd 命令导航到要在终端中设置版本控制目录,现在你可以像这样初始化 Git 存储库: git init 这将创建一个名为 .git 新子目录(Windows 下该目录隐藏),其中包含所有必需存储库文件...### 查看所有远程分支 git branch -r # 将主分支重新设置本地分支 $ git rebase origin/master # 将分支推送到远程存储库源并对其进行跟踪 $ git

    70430

    给开源库提交 pr,让更多人知道你

    下面自己平时维护 git经验做一个总结,也算是给一些想给开源库提 pr 同学一些微小帮助。 如果有更好方法,可以评论补充一下,谢谢大家。...具体流程 想给开源库提 pr,第一步肯定是我们要有他们库,并且可以进行开发。接下来就拿 vue 库做一个示例,看官们可以边看边和我一起操作。...本地创建分支,进行开发 摩拳擦掌,开始吧,开发之前你要确定好具体开发哪个分支,因为我们拉下来代码只有默认分支,但是有些开源库是有很多分支,不同功能或者不同版本在不一样分支上,这个在开发之前要确定好...这个时候就有了本地 weex 分支,来改动点东西,执行一下最熟悉 git 提交代码过程。 一顿操作之后(其实只是简单改了说明文档,?),我们开始提交修改代码。 ?...有些看官可能觉得问题很多,但是这不是为了让大家更潇洒提 pr ,所以有问题还是要说清楚

    93910

    git相关问题解析,你想要都有🔥

    /REPOSITORY.git (push) 设置git提交用户信息 这里牵涉到提交代码一些数据统计,了解一下会很有帮助可以看下这篇文章: 语雀:github/gitlab/gitee 个人主页无法统计提交记录...发现gitlab上代码数据统计采集数据方式应该不唯一,具体描述如下: 给后端项目设置了项目级git用户配置,后端同事提交时候直接提 前端项目提交使用系统级git用户配置 做完这些之后发现,...具有最高优先级,无论你是否设置相关换行符风格转化属性,你都可以和团队保持一致; 使用 * text=auto 可以定义开启全局换行符转换; 使用 *.bat text eol=crlf...就可以保证 Windows 批处理文件在 checkout 至工作区时,始终被转换为 CRLF 风格换行符; 使用 *.sh text eol=lf 就可以保证 Bash 脚本无论在哪个平台上...--mixed 默认,可以不用带该参数,用于重置暂存区文件与上一次提交(commit)保持一致,工作区文件内容保持不变。

    1.3K20

    使用git上传我们故事

    想把想告诉你上传到git上,可是还不会使用 原谅之前没有努力学习,这一次,想好好做个总结 前两天写了好多树代码,想上传到git上面,但好多命令和操作差不多忘了 关于为什么使用git?...执行git reset HEAD filename取消暂存, 文件状态Modified 创建版本库(init) 首先我们先要确定需要把哪个文件夹里边东西上传到git上进行管理 比如我们现在需要管理firstRepository...git,进行文件管理了 添加文件(add) 我们可以在命令行中执行ls命令,就可以看到文件夹中所有的文件,但是如果你电脑没有把隐藏文件设置成可见,可能就看不见,所以使用ls -a命令就可以看见 现在我们手动创建一个...我们先来了解一下git是如何一步步记录提交过程 图片来源于网络 在上图当中有一个灰色部分HEAD,相当于指针,绿色部分是每次提交之后版本,指针指向哪,就回到了哪个版本 可以使用git status...本文章适合去理解git原理,上面是总结git命令,上传到我github上了,需要自提 https://github.com/BuLaiChuang/git-.git 链接

    28920

    实习生 Git 不熟练,还没脸去问是种什么体验…

    文章目录 尴尬 Git 概述 git 分区原理 Git 常用指令 设置用户签名 初始化本地库 查看本地库状态 添加暂存区 提交本地库 修改文件 查看历史版本 版本 Git 分支操作 分支基本操作 查看分支...---- 查看历史版本 git reflog 查看版本信息 git log 查看版本详细信息 如果是想快速浏览版本信息,可以使用 reflog 即可,毕竟公司项目版本迭代信息可能已经很多了,想看详细日志也得看你有没有那个精力了...---- Git 分支操作版本控制过程中,同时推进多个任务,每个任务,我们就可以创建每个任务单独分支。...(分支底层其实也是指针引用) 分支基本操作 查看分支 小伙子,不要一上来就想着创建分支嘛。先看看前辈们已经达到了哪个高度了嘛。...---- 合并冲突解决 冲突产生表现:后面状态 MERGING 打开冲突文件可以看到冲突地方: hello git! hello atguigu!

    23910

    实习生 Git 不熟练,还没脸去问是种什么体验...

    文章目录 尴尬 Git 概述 git 分区原理 Git 常用指令 设置用户签名 初始化本地库 查看本地库状态 添加暂存区 提交本地库 修改文件 查看历史版本 版本 Git 分支操作 分支基本操作 查看分支...查看历史版本 git reflog 查看版本信息 git log 查看版本详细信息 如果是想快速浏览版本信息,可以使用 reflog 即可,毕竟公司项目版本迭代信息可能已经很多了,想看详细日志也得看你有没有那个精力了...Git 分支操作版本控制过程中,同时推进多个任务,每个任务,我们就可以创建每个任务单独分支。...使用分支意味着程序员可以把自己工作从开发主线上分离开来,开发自己分支时候,不会影响主线分支运行。对于初学者而言,分支可以简单理解为副本,一个分支就是一个单独副本。...(分支底层其实也是指针引用) 分支基本操作 查看分支 小伙子,不要一上来就想着创建分支嘛。先看看前辈们已经达到了哪个高度了嘛。

    32410

    简单聊聊 GOPATH 与 Go Modules

    要是面试问这个问题,算输。 什么是GOPATH 胖虎:那 GOPATH 呢? 实习生:GOPATH 是Golang 1.5版本之前一个重要环境变量配置,是存放 Golang 项目代码文件路径。...可以看到有三个文件夹。 •bin 存放编译生成二进制文件。比如 执行命令 go get github.com/google/gops,bin目录会生成 gops 二进制文件。...墙裂要求官方,实现存放项目路径自由和不同版本管理。...,你想引用哪个版本就用哪个版本,你地盘,你做主。...基于 go1.17.3 版本 胖虎:咳咳,学长教学时间开始了,新创建一个空目录test_mod,进入该目录,执行命令 //test_mod 项目名称 go mod int test_mod 会在根目录生成一个

    85620

    Git学习总结

    git push -u origin master 上面的命令将本地 master 分支推送到 origin 主机,同时指定 origin 默认主机,后面就可以不加任何参数使用 git push 了。...当你多次使用 git stash 命令后,你栈里将充满了未提交代码,这时候你会对将哪个版本应用回来有些困惑, git stash list 命令可以将当前 Git 栈信息打印出来,你只需要将找到对应版本号...那么在 push 时候,远程就知道这个push来自于哪个email. 但有时候在公司时候,有的仓库是公司,有的仓库是自己github。...这个时候就可以设置global配置了,而是在自己仓库中设置 git config --local user.email "react.dong.yu@gmail.com" 问题三 使用 windows...可以git check-ignore 命令检查: git check-ignore -v App.class 问题四 为什么生成 ssh key 添加到了 github 中 然后 也 remote

    43940

    开发工具总结(3)之GitGitHub快速入门图文全面详解

    Branch---软件开发过程中分支,保存了从版本某一特定点(不一定是版本库建立时)到当前信息。...所以千万不要怕看不懂英文而放弃GitHub。 ◆ 2.需要访问外国网站? 不需要,直接在浏览器打开就可以,速度还是很快。...(如果你喜欢图形化界面,还可以安装一个TortoiseGit,这个不是现在要讲解重点,有兴趣可以去百度一下怎么使用。)...以前没有安装git客户端时候,想下载github库都是选择下载zip到本地。...最新内容 ---- 三、一些实用git命令操作 (一)使用git克隆(下载)一个仓库或单个文件夹 注意:文件夹名可以随意写 ,仓库地址替换成你想要下载仓库地址。

    79330

    【AI大模型】从零开始运用LORA微调ChatGLM3-6B大模型并私有数据训练

    这种技术核心思想是通过在原有的模型中引入少量额外参数来实现模型微调,而不是改变模型全部参数。这样做可以在保持预训练模型大部分知识同时,使模型适应特定任务或数据集。...torch版本即可 4.3 git lfs下载 想要使用git拉大数据需要下载git lfs 乌班图操作(不同系统操作不一样 mac使用brew直接安装) 在Ubuntu系统上安装Git Large...安装Git LFS: 添加仓库后,你可以通过运行以下命令来安装Git LFS: sudo apt-get install git-lfs 设置Git LFS: 安装完成后,你需要运行以下命令来设置Git...,请问有什么可以帮助您?"}]}..., {"role": "assistant", "content": "作为 大数据小禅,优势包括对自然语言理解和生成能力,致力于用户提供准确、有用回答和解决方案。"}]}

    2K01

    你还不会在GitHub上分享项目

    在开始菜单里找到"Git"->"Git Bash",会弹出 Git 命令窗口,你可以在该窗口进行 Git 操作。...这里推荐一下Everything这个windows下文件查找工具。别再用资源管理器来查找了。那龟速度你不着急。不过平常就要做好分类。...文本编辑器设置Git默认使用文本编辑器, 一般可能会是 Vi 或者 Vim。...版本库: 工作区有一个隐藏目录 .git,这个不算工作区,而是 Git 版本库。下面这个图展示了工作区、版本库中暂存区和版本库之间关系:图中左侧工作区,右侧版本库。...如果要自己定义要新建项目目录名称,可以在上面的命令末尾指定新名字:$ git clone git://github.com/schacon/grit.git mygrit复制代码配置git 设置使用

    67830
    领券